Query 4: Are there limitations to utilizing railway system diagrams as sources of historic info?
These depictions signify a particular perspective and should not seize the total complexity of the B&O’s operations. They might omit sure particulars or emphasize others primarily based on the needs of the creators. Scale and accuracy limitations are inherent to cartographic representations, requiring cautious interpretation and cross-referencing with different historic sources to substantiate the data displayed.

Query 6: The place can somebody find and entry historic diagrams of the Baltimore and Ohio Railroad?
These visuals could also be present in varied archives, libraries, and historic societies. The Library of Congress, the Nationwide Archives, and state-level historic organizations are potential repositories. On-line databases and digital collections may additionally present entry to scanned or digitized copies. Personal collectors and specialised map sellers might provide originals or reproductions on the market.

Ideas for Analyzing Baltimore and Ohio Railroad Diagrams
To maximise the informational yield when analyzing historic representations of the Baltimore and Ohio Railroad, a structured and detail-oriented method is really helpful. The following pointers present steerage for extracting significant insights from these invaluable assets.
Tip 1: Date the Diagram Exactly: Correct relationship is paramount. Railroad networks, station areas, and surrounding infrastructure developed over time. Pinpointing the precise yr or interval of publication gives important context for decoding the information offered.
Tip 2: Cross-Reference with Different Sources: Confirm the data offered with various historic information, resembling annual stories, engineering surveys, and modern newspaper articles. This triangulation helps to validate accuracy and fill in gaps.
Tip 3: Analyze Route Connectivity: Fastidiously look at the routes depicted, taking note of connections with different railroads, industrial spurs, and key geographic options. Understanding the networks connectivity reveals the B&O’s strategic positioning inside the broader transportation panorama.
Tip 4: Assess Station Infrastructure: Consider the presence and sort of infrastructure at every station. Notice the scale of the station, the presence of freight yards, restore services, or different specialised buildings. This evaluation gives insights into the station’s position inside the B&O system.
Tip 5: Establish Adjustments Over Time: Evaluate sequential diagrams to establish infrastructure modifications. Notice the addition of latest traces, the relocation of stations, or the implementation of technological upgrades. These adjustments mirror the B&O’s adaptation to evolving financial and operational calls for.
Tip 6: Think about Scale and Accuracy: Pay attention to the restrictions imposed by the diagram’s scale and projection. Distortions and simplifications are inherent in cartographic representations. Train warning when making exact measurements or spatial analyses.
Tip 7: Pay Consideration to Legend and Symbols: Totally evaluate the diagram’s legend to know the that means of symbols, line types, and different visible cues. Constant interpretation is essential for correct evaluation.
